Iranian drones struck Harir Air Base in the Shaqlawa region of Iraqi Kurdistan, a forward operating base used by US-led coalition forces and Kurdish Peshmerga units. A French soldier was killed — the first French military fatality of the war — and six coalition soldiers were wounded, one critically. The drones struck a logistics compound and a barracks building. The Islamic Resistance in Iraq claimed responsibility for the attack. French President Macron confirmed the death and called it "an attack against France and its allies." The strike follows the previous day's fatal drone attack at the Mala Qara base near Erbil and marks a continued escalation in Iran's campaign against coalition positions in Iraq. The Iraqi government condemned the attack and summoned the Iranian ambassador for the second consecutive day. CENTCOM announced it would deploy additional Patriot batteries to protect coalition infrastructure in Iraq.
